The American International School of Lagos Nigeria is a globally recognised not-for-profit school serving over 500 children from some 50+ nationalities. Situated on Victoria Island, the commercial heart of Lagos, the school’s highly qualified faculty and staff designs meaningful learning experiences which empower students and develop the whole child. Assistant to the Facilities Director Job Type Full Time Qualification BA/BSc/HND Experience: Location Lagos Job Field Administration / Facilities Key Responsibilities: Provide high-level administrative and operational support to the Facilities Director/department Coordinate campus operations, ensuring that buildings, grounds, and residential flats are maintained to high standards of safety, cleanliness, compliance, and operational efficiency. Assist in managing staff housing, including assignments, maintenance, and compliance with local regulations. Oversee maintenance requests, repairs, and preventive maintenance schedules. Track attendance and work schedules of maintenance and custodial staff to ensure proper staffing and timely completion of tasks. Supervise custodial and maintenance staff, providing guidance and support as needed. Manage vendors for maintenance, cleaning, and facility-related services, ensuring quality and cost-efficiency. Support procurement processes via Procurify, including monitoring budgets, orders, and approvals. Assist in planning and executing facility improvement projects and campus renovations. Ensure compliance with health, safety, and environmental regulations across campus facilities and staff housing. Coordinate across departments to resolve facility-related issues and maintain smooth operations. Support international staff housing management, including onboarding, housing orientation, and ongoing support. Administrative Support Provide daily administrative support to the Facilities Director, including calendar management, scheduling, and report preparation. Handle correspondence and communications on behalf of the Facilities Director. Maintain documentation related to campus facilities, maintenance, and staff housing. Track attendance and work schedules of maintenance and custodial staff to ensure proper staffing levels and timely completion of tasks. Monitor staff performance and report any attendance or operational issues to the Facilities Director. Campus and Staff Housing Management Oversee staff housing allocations, occupancy records, and maintenance schedules. Coordinate move-ins, move-outs, and housing-related requests. Ensure compliance with housing policies and facilitate communication between staff and facilities teams. Assist the facility director in monitoring and resolving housing or campus facility concerns promptly. Oversee the maintenance and upkeep of staff housing units (flats). Assist the facility director in coordinating cleaning, repairs, and preparation of flats for incoming and departing staff. Assist the facility director in conducting regular inspections of staff housing to ensure safety and proper maintenance. Supervise custodial staff responsible for cleaning staff flats and residential areas. Maintain inventory of furniture, appliances, and fixtures in staff housing units. Maintenance Requests Receive, track, and coordinate maintenance requests from staff and campus departments. Assign tasks to facilities staff or external contractors and ensure timely completion. Maintain accurate records of maintenance activities and provide updates to the Facilities Director. Identify recurring issues and propose improvements to campus operations. Procurement and Purchase Orders Manage the Procurify platform for purchase requests, approvals, and order tracking. Coordinate with vendors, facilities teams, and finance to ensure timely procurement. Maintain accurate purchase order records and assist with budget tracking and reporting. Operational Coordination Liaise with facilities staff to support maintenance, renovations, and operational projects. Assist in planning and executing campus events or projects requiring facilities support. Qualification & Training A Bachelor’s degree in Facilities Management, Engineering, Business Administration, or a related field. Experience: or background in the international education: sector or international operations is highly desirable. Preferred: Experience: managing staff housing, campus facilities, and maintenance operations, including cleaning and custodial services. Knowledge of local housing regulations and vendor management. Experience: working with international staff housing and coordinating support for diverse teams. Familiarity with procurement processes and facility management software, such as Procurify.
